The World Cup hero and Indian all rounder Yuvraj Singh is ready for Twenty 20 after battling with cancer this young one will be seen in two match series against New Zealand on Saturday.
30-year-old Yuvraj Singh who underwent for chemotherapy in March and April in the USA to treat a rare germ-cell tumour between his lungs which was diagnosed late last year.
Last year Yuvraj was awarded Man of the Match in the World Cup, but he missed competitive cricket two home test against the West Indies last November.
But Yuvraj recalled by the selecters as soon as he was declared fit by the doctors at the National Cricket Academy in Banglore where he had light training in July.
Yuvraj said “It is hard to believe that I will be playing for India again.”

The first match on Saturday in Vishakhapatnam and the second will be played in Chennai.
The New Zealand are hoping to end their Indian tour on a high by winning the Twenty20 games after beaten with 2-0 in the recent Test series.
“We are here to win but whatever happens we have to make sure we learn from the series because it’s great preparation,” Oram said.
